A regular meeting of the Board of Public Works & Safety met at 10:00 A.M.
on August 5, 1968, with all members present. The minutes of the last
meeting were reviewed and approved.
RETIREMENT FROM FIRE DEPARTMENT - ANTHONY C. KOVATCH
Upon the recommendation of Fire Chief McHenry, the Board accepted and
approved the application and declaration for retirement of Anthony C.
Kovatch effective September 2, 1968, Mr. Kovatch having been appointed
February 16, 1948, and having served more than 20 years.
NOTICE OF RETIREMENT FROM FIRE DEPARTMENT - FIRE CHIEF CECIL McHENRY
Notice of retirement September 9, 1968, or as soon thereafter as a
successor is appointed,.was filed with the Board by Chief McHenry. The
Board expressed its appreciation of the long service of Chief McHenry
and regret at his coming retirement.
FIRE PROTECTION AGREEMENT - PORTAGE TOWNSHIP
Communication from James A. Bickel, City Controller, regarding the Fire
protection agreement with Portage Township was read and ordered filed.
Mr. Frisk will write the Porta§e Township Trustees to determine their
intentions as to future fire protection for Portage. Township outside the
city limits of South Bend.

POLICE DEPARTMENT TRAFFIC REPORT FOR JULY, 1968
Traffic arrest report f6r July, 1968, by the Police Department was reviewed
and ordered filed.
SPECIAL POL ICE`'OFF ICER' S BOND
Special police officer's bond on behalf of Mozelle Toth, Mishawaka, Indiana,
employed at Robertson's, was approved by the Board.
PARKING PROHIBITED - S. CHAPIN STREET FROM WESTERN SOUTH TO R R VIADUCT
Upon the recommendation of Clem F. Hazinski, Traffic Director, the Board
approved the following:
To prohibit parking on both sides of S. Chapin Street, from
Western south to the Railroad viaduct, being 400 and 500 blocks
of 6outh Chapin Street.
STREET SIGNS APPROVED
Upon the recommendation of Clem F. Hazinski, Traffic Engineer, the Board
approved the following signs:
30 MPH speed limit sign -- on the southwest corner of Phillipa and
Ford. Sign to face west.
30 MPH speed limit sign -- on the northeast corner of Pulaski and
Ford. Sign to face east.
